Date: Mon, 10 Apr 2017 15:08:12 +0000 (UTC) From: Mathieu Arnold <mat@FreeBSD.org> To: 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org Subject: svn commit: r438174 - head/Mk/Uses Message-ID: <201704101508.v3AF8CCv088777@repo.freebsd.org>
next in thread | raw e-mail | index | archive | help
Author: mat Date: Mon Apr 10 15:08:12 2017 New Revision: 438174 URL: https://svnweb.freebsd.org/changeset/ports/438174 Log: Introduces USES=php:pecl. It sets sane defaults when fetching from http://pecl.php.net/. Sponsored by: Absolight Differential Revision: https://reviews.freebsd.org/D10281 Modified: head/Mk/Uses/php.mk Modified: head/Mk/Uses/php.mk ============================================================================== --- head/Mk/Uses/php.mk Mon Apr 10 15:06:19 2017 (r438173) +++ head/Mk/Uses/php.mk Mon Apr 10 15:08:12 2017 (r438174) @@ -15,6 +15,7 @@ # - mod : Want the Apache Module for PHP. # - web : Want the Apache Module or the CGI version of PHP. # - embed : Want the embedded library version of PHP. +# - pecl : Fetches from PECL. # # If the port requires a predefined set of PHP extensions, they can be # listed in this way: @@ -89,6 +90,17 @@ DEV_WARNING+= "USES=php:phpize is includ . if ${php_ARGS:Mext} && ${php_ARGS:Mzend} DEV_WARNING+= "USES=php:ext is included in USES=php:zend, so it is not needed" . endif +. if ${php_ARGS:Mext} && ${php_ARGS:Mpecl} +DEV_WARNING+= "USES=php:ext is included in USES=php:pecl, so it is not needed" +. endif + +. if ${php_ARGS:Mpecl} +php_ARGS+= ext +EXTRACT_SUFX= .tgz +MASTER_SITES= http://pecl.php.net/get/ +PKGNAMEPREFIX= pecl- +DIST_SUBDIR= PECL +. endif PHPBASE?= ${LOCALBASE} . if exists(${PHPBASE}/etc/php.conf)
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201704101508.v3AF8CCv088777>